Index of /menu/89/2458/6540/31970/thumbnail
Name
Last modified
Size
Description
Parent Directory
-
Mj8Aw5aXzvX0skMr_1725778578.jfif
2024-09-08 09:56
7.4K
6kVmpVbbWYVajQ8X_1703485958.jpg
2023-12-25 09:32
7.2K
Apache/2.4.41 (Ubuntu) Server at img.jomaestro.com Port 80